From Owen Delaney: Hi. I've diff'd a .log file generated by openambit and an .xml file generated by the moveslink windows app, and there's a fair amount of differences. For some reason, openambit isn't generating .xml files as well, just the .log files. the .openambit/movescount folder didn't previously exist, so I created it, but only .log files appear there when I sync, no .xml files. The activity is an indoor swim. Thanks Owen

From Emil: Hi Owen Swimming is actually one of the part I haven't been able to test at all, so I'm not that suprised it doesn't work. :) There is actually already an issue for investigating, this, #14. Would it be possible for you to record the USB communication from moveslink? (described in FAQ https://sourceforge.net/p/openambit/wiki/Ambit%20protocol%20dissection%20-%20reverse%20engineering/). Note that you would need at least one new log entry for moveslink to read the log, but then it reads the complete memory, so you don't need another swimming activity. Could you also attach the log file from .openambit/ ?
